12 Tips to Find Fake International Conferences

Here are some tips to help you find and avoid such fake international conferences:

1. Check the Conference Website

Start by visiting the conference website. Look for a professional design, clear information about the conference, and contact details. Be wary of websites with poor design, spelling errors, or missing contact information.

2. Review The Organizers

Research the organizers and their reputation. Legitimate conferences are often organized by well-known universities, research institutions, or reputable conference organizers. If the organizers are obscure or unverifiable, it’s a red flag.

3. Verify the Venue

Check the conference venue. Scam conferences may list prestigious venues that they don’t actually have access to. You can verify the venue’s availability through official channels or by contacting the venue directly.

4. Examine the Speakers and Committees

Legitimate conferences have respected speakers and organizing committees. Search for the credentials and affiliations of these individuals. Fake conferences often list speakers with no clear expertise or affiliation.

5. Review the Call for Papers

Inspect the call for papers or abstract submissions. Legitimate conferences have specific themes and topics. If the call for papers is too broad or unrelated to the conference theme, it may be a scam.

6. Check Registration Fees:

Be cautious of excessively high or low registration fees. Some scam conferences charge exorbitant fees to exploit researchers, while others offer unrealistically low fees to attract a large number of participants. Compare the fees to similar conferences.

7. Look for the Peer Review Process

Reputable conferences have a peer-review process to evaluate submitted papers. If there’s no mention of peer review or if all submissions are accepted without review, it’s a warning sign.

8. Contact Previous Participants

Try to contact researchers who have attended previous editions of the conference. They can provide insights into their experiences and whether the conference is legitimate.

9. Search for Reviews and Feedback

Look for online reviews or feedback from previous attendees. Researchers often share their experiences on academic forums or social media. Scam conferences will likely have negative reviews and warnings.

10. Beware of Unsolicited Invitations

If you receive unsolicited conference invitations via email, be cautious. Legitimate conferences typically don’t spam researchers with invitations.

11. Check the Conference History

Investigate the conference’s history. Legitimate conferences have a track record of successful past events. Scam conferences may change names or locations frequently.

12. Trust Your Instincts

If something feels off or too good to be true, trust your instincts. It’s better to skip a suspicious conference than to waste time and resources on a scam.

By following these tips and conducting thorough research, you can increase your chances of identifying and avoiding fake or scam international conferences.

Scopus Indexed Journals: Enhancing Visibility and Impact in Academic Publishing

Understanding Scopus Indexing:

Scopus, established by Elsevier, is a comprehensive abstract and citation database that covers a wide range of academic disciplines. It encompasses millions of articles, conference papers, book chapters, and other scholarly documents. Scopus aims to provide a comprehensive overview of research output globally and facilitates easy access to high-quality research.

A Scopus-indexed journal is a scholarly journal that has been evaluated and accepted by Scopus for inclusion in its database. Journals are assessed based on a set of rigorous criteria, including the quality and impact of their content, editorial processes, and overall reputation within the academic community. Once a journal meets these standards, it is indexed in Scopus, making its published articles discoverable to a wide audience.

Significance of Scopus Indexing:

  1. Increased Visibility: Scopus indexing enhances the visibility and discoverability of research articles. Researchers can reach a larger audience, which can lead to increased citations and potential collaborations. Institutions and funding agencies also consider Scopus-indexed publications when evaluating the impact and productivity of researchers.
  2. Quality Assurance: Scopus employs a stringent evaluation process for indexing journals, ensuring that only high-quality publications are included. Researchers can have confidence in the credibility and reliability of articles published in Scopus-indexed journals.
  3. Citation Tracking and Metrics: Scopus provides citation tracking and various metrics, such as h-index, to gauge the impact and influence of published research. Authors can track how often their work is cited, identify key trends in their field, and assess their own research impact.
  4. Collaboration Opportunities: Scopus indexing fosters collaboration by connecting researchers from different disciplines and institutions. Researchers can identify potential collaborators based on shared research interests, thereby promoting interdisciplinary research and innovation.
  5. Research Assessment: Many universities and research institutions consider Scopus-indexed publications as a criterion for evaluating researchers, granting promotions, and allocating research funding. Being associated with Scopus-indexed journals enhances the academic reputation and credibility of researchers and institutions.

Scopus is an abstract indexing database that currently has over 76.8 million core records. Scopus coverage focuses on primary document types from serial publications. Primary means that the author is identical to the researcher in charge of the presented findings.

Scopus does not include secondary document types,
where the author is not identical to the person behind the presented research, such as obituaries and book reviews. In this article, the list of document types covered in Scopus presented.

Document types covered in Scopus

1. Article

The article is original research or opinion. Articles in peer-reviewed journals are usually several pages in length, most often subdivided into sections: abstract, introduction, materials & methods, results, conclusions, discussion and references. However, case reports, technical and research notes and short communications are also considered to be articles and may be as short as one page in length.

Articles in trade journals are typically shorter than in peer-reviewed journals, and may also be as brief as one page in length.

2. Article-in-Press (AiP)

Article-in-Press (AiP) is the accepted article made available online before the official publication.

3. Book

A whole monograph or the entire book. Book type is assigned to the whole. Additionally, for books with individual chapters, each chapter, along with a general item summarizing the book, is also indexed with the source type Book.

4. Chapter

A book chapter is a complete chapter in a book or book series volume where the item is identified as a chapter by a heading or section indicator.

5. Conference paper

A conference paper is an original article reporting data presented at a conference or symposium.

Conference papers are of any length reporting data from a conference, with the exception of conference abstracts.

Conference papers may range in length and content from full papers and published conference summaries to short items as short as one page in length.

6. Data paper

Data papers are searchable metadata documents describing an online accessible dataset or group of datasets. The intent of a data paper is to offer descriptive information on the related dataset(s) focusing on data collection, distinguishing features, access, and potential reuse rather than information on data processing and analysis.

7. Editorial

Editorial is a summary of several articles or provides editorial opinions or news.

Editorials are typically identified as editorial, introduction, leading article, preface or foreword, and are usually listed at the beginning of the table of contents.

8. Erratum

Erratum is a report of an error, correction or retraction of a previously published paper. Errata are short items citing errors in, corrections to, or retractions of a previously published article in the same journal to which a
citation is provided.

9. Letter

Letter to or correspondence with the editor. Letters are individual letters or replies. Each individual letter or reply is processed as a single item.

10. Note

Note, discussion or commentary. Notes are short items that are not readily suited to other item types. They may or may not share characteristics of other item types, such as author, affiliation and references. Discussions and commentaries that follow an article are defined as notes and considered to be items in their own right.

Notes also include questions and answers, as well as comments on other (often translated) articles. In trade journals, notes are generally shorter than half a page in length.

11. Retracted article

Published articles that the author(s) or publisher has requested to retract. Articles with a published retraction note will be updated to the document type “Retracted.” Usually, these articles are indicated with the words retracted or retraction.

12. Review

A significant review of original research also includes conference papers. Reviews typically have an extensive bibliography.

Educational items that review specific issues within the literature are also considered to be reviews. As non-original articles, reviews lack the most typical sections of original articles such as materials & methods and results.

13. Short survey

Short or mini-review of original research. Short surveys are similar to reviews, but usually are shorter (not more than a few pages) and with a less extensive bibliography.

1. Pythagoras’s Theorem

The Pythagorean Theorem is a statement in geometry that shows the relationship between the lengths of the sides of a right triangle – a triangle with one 90-degree angle​​.

Pythagoras’s-Theorem equation

Applications of Pythagoras’s Theorem

The Pythagorean Theorem widely used in Architecture and Construction, Laying Out Square Angles, Surveying, and  Navigation.

2. Logarithms

A logarithm is the power to which a number must be raised in order to get some other number .​

Logarithms equation

Applications of Logarithms

Logarithms widely used to measure Earthquake intensity measurement, Acid measurement of solutions(pH Value), Sound intensity measurements, and express larger value.

3. Calculus

Calculus is a form of mathematics which was developed from algebra and geometry. It is made up of two interconnected topics, differential calculus, and integral calculus. ​

10. Navier – Stokes Equation

This equations arise from applying Isaac Newton’s second law to fluid motion, together with the assumption that the stress in the fluid is the sum of a diffusing viscousterm (proportional to the gradient of velocity) and a pressure term hence describing viscous flow

Navier Stokes-Equation

Navier Stokes equation is used to describe the flow characteristics of a Newtonian fluid. A fluid in which relation between stress and rate of strain is linear. In other words, a fluid obeys Newton law of viscosity. Honey, Benzene, Water, Kerosene oil, are just a few examples of a Newtonian fluid.

11. Maxwell’s Equations

Maxwell’s equations are a set of partial differential equations that, together with the Lorentz force law, form the foundation of classical electromagnetism, classical optics, and electric circuits. The equations provide a mathematical model for electric, optical and radio technologies, such as power generation, electric motors, wireless communication, lenses, radar etc.

Maxwell’s-Equations equation

Maxwell’s equations often involve calculus, there are simplified versions of the equations. These versions only work in certain circumstances, but can be useful and save a lot of trouble.

12. Second Law of Thermodynamics

The second law of thermodynamics states that the total entropy of an isolated system can never decrease over time, and is constant if and only if all processes are reversible. Isolated systems spontaneously evolve towards thermodynamic equilibrium, the state with maximum entropy.

14. Schrodinger’s Equation

Schrödinger equation is a mathematical equation that describes the changes over time of a physical system in which quantum effects, such as wave particle duality, are significant. 

Schrodinger’s-Equation

The Schrodinger equation is used to find the allowed energy levels of quantum mechanical systems (such as atoms, or transistors). The associated wavefunction gives the probability of finding the particle at a certain position. The solution to this equation is a wave that describes the quantum aspects of a system.

15. Information Theory

Information entropy (Entropy) is the average rate at which information is produced by a stochastic source of data. The measure of information entropy associated with each possible data value is the negative logarithm of the probability mass function  ​

Information-Theory equation

Applications of Information Theory

  • Lossless data compression (e.g. ZIP files).
  • Lossy data compression (e.g. MP3s and JPEGs).
  • Channel coding (e.g. for digital subscriber line (DSL)).
  • An invention of the Compact Disc(CD).
  • The feasibility of mobile phones.
  • The development of the Internet, numerous other fields.
